深度评测显示,XSS防护对于保护网站和用户数据安全至关重要。最佳实践包括对输入内容进行严格过滤和验证,使用安全的编程方法,以及及时更新和修补系统漏洞。通过遵循这些实践,可以有效防止XSS攻击,确保网站和用户信息的安全。
在网络安全领域,XSS(跨站脚本攻击)是一种常见的攻击手段,它允许攻击者注入恶意脚本到目标网站中,从而窃取敏感信息或者进行其他恶意活动,对于任何网站来说,实施有效的XSS防护措施至关重要。
我们需要理解XSS攻击的原理,XSS攻击就是攻击者通过各种手段将恶意脚本注入到网页中,当其他用户访问这个网页时,这些恶意脚本就会被执行,从而达到攻击的目的。
为了防止XSS攻击,我们可以采取以下几种措施:
1、对用户输入进行严格的验证和过滤,确保它们不会包含任何可能被解释为脚本的字符或字符串。
2、使用HTTP Only Cookies来存储敏感信息,这样即使用户浏览器被攻击,攻击者也无法获取到这些信息。
3、对输出的数据进行编码,确保它们不会被浏览器错误地解释为脚本。
4、使用Content Security Policy(CSP)来限制浏览器加载和执行的资源,从而防止恶意脚本的执行。